Vilka problem löser cachen?
Vilka problem löser cachen?

Video: Vilka problem löser cachen?

Video: Vilka problem löser cachen?
Video: Cage The Elephant - Trouble (Official Video) 2024, November
Anonim

Cacher är användbara när två eller flera komponenter behöver utbyta data och komponenterna utför överföring med olika hastigheter. Cacher löser sig överföringen problem genom att tillhandahålla en buffert med mellanhastighet mellan komponenterna.

Folk frågar också, varför är cacheminne användbart?

Cacher är användbar eftersom de kan öka hastigheten på genomsnittet minne tillgång, och de gör det utan att ta upp lika mycket fysisk plats som de nedre delarna av minne hierarki. De förbättrar (prestandakritiska) minne tillgång till tid genom att utnyttja rumslig och tidsmässig lokalitet.

Dessutom, hur hjälper cacher till att förbättra prestanda Varför använder inte system fler eller större cachar om de är så användbara? Svar: Cacher tillåta komponenter med olika hastighet till kommunicera Mer effektivt genom att lagra data från de långsammare enhet, tillfälligt, in a snabbare enhet ( cachen ).

Med tanke på detta, vad används cachen till?

Cache är en liten mängd minne som är en del av CPU - närmare CPU än RAM. Det är Begagnade att tillfälligt lagra instruktioner och data som processorn sannolikt kommer att återanvända.

Hur lagras data i cachen?

Datorn använder detta minne för att lagra ofta använda data . Meningen med lagring vissa data i cache minne är att påskynda användningsprocessen av lagrade data på detta minne. I moderna datorer är cache minnet är lagrat mellan processorn och DRAM; detta kallas nivå 2 cache . Detta kallas en minnesbuffert.

Rekommenderad: